Lists, journals, teacher-student conference, drawing illustrations, using imagination, restating a problem in ...Jul 22, 2014 · Write a single word or phrase in the center of a blank sheet of paper and circle it. Dr. Rico calls this word or phrase the nucleus. 2. Let your thoughts flow and jot down every word that comes to mind around the first word. 3. Circle the new words and draw lines to connect. In this article, we explain what prewriting is, …Listing. Making a list can help you develop ideas for writing once you have a particular focus. If you want to take a stand on a subject, you might list the top ten reasons why you’re taking that particular stand. Or, once you have a focused topic, you might list the different aspects of that topic.
